Economy Picking Up Speed | Weekly Market Commentary | May 17, 2021

The economic recovery continues, as the recipe of vaccines, the reopening, and record stimulus all have combined to produce what should be one of the best years for growth ever. Although some economic indicators could be peaking or about to peak, the stage is set for...

Amazing Earnings Season | Weekly Market Commentary | May 10, 2021

It’s embarrasing to admit this but in our earnings season preview on April 12, when the consensus estimate reflected a nearly 24% increase, we wrote that S&P 500 Index earnings growth for the first quarter could potentially exceed 30%. Fast forward to today and...